Inspection Information
Facility Name: Tipp Aquatic Center (Activity)
Facility Type: Special Use Pool
[?] Inspection type: Standard
Inspection date: 23-May-2022
Violations: A summary of the violations found during the inspection are listed below.
3701-31-04 (B)(1)
Critical At time of inspection, observed insufficient protection from entrapment in the netting area of the activity structure. To correct this issue, operator stated that three vertical cargo nets are to be placed to prevent access and entrapment. Operator stated that a lifeguard will be placed in netting area to ensure patron safety.
Do not operate the pool when an imminent health hazard is present. Fix the imminent health hazard before the pool is put back into operation.
3701-31-04 (B)(6)
Equipment was not maintained per manufacturers specifications. Observed play structure missing a bolt causing the structure to be overly flexible. (On the side nearest the tanning chairs). Repair.
All equipment must be maintained in accordance with the manufacturers specifications.
Comments
At time of inspection, netting around play structure posed an entrapment hazard. Do not operate the pool until this entrapment hazard has been resolved. Re-inspection to occur on or after 5/27/2022.

Ensure that all main drains are secure, up to date on certification, and not expired. Provide proof that these requirements have been met. If expired, the drain covers must be replaced immediately.

Additionally, ensure all lifeguard certifications are up to date before opening.
